1110059E24Rik Activators fall into three primary classes: histone deacetylase inhibitors, DNA methyltransferase inhibitors, and chemicals that alter chromatin structure. Histone deacetylase inhibitors including Trichostatin A, Sodium Butyrate, Valproic Acid, and Vorinostat promote chromatin relaxation, indirectly enhancing the activity of 1110059E24Rik by creating a more accessible chromatin structure for 1110059E24Rik to function. By promoting a relaxed chromatin state, these compounds enhance the ability of 1110059E24Rik to function, thereby enhancing its functional activity.
Another class of 1110059E24Rik activators are DNA methyltransferase inhibitors including 5-Azacytidine, Decitabine, Zebularine, and Azacitidine. These compounds decrease DNA methylation, thus indirectly enhancing the activity of 1110059E24Rik by making the chromatin more accessible for its function. Lastly, chemicals that alter chromatin structure, such as Mithramycin A, Etoposide, Genistein, and Daunorubicin, also act as 1110059E24Rik activators. Mithramycin A inhibits the DNA-binding activity of transcription factors leading to altered chromatin compaction and indirectly enhancing 1110059E24Rik activity. Etoposide, a topoisomerase II inhibitor, can lead to alterations in DNA supercoiling and chromatin structure, thereby indirectly enhancing 1110059E24Rik activity. Genistein, a tyrosine kinase inhibitor, can influence signal transduction pathways that control chromatin structure, thereby indirectly enhancing 1110059E24Rik activity. Daunorubicin, through its intercalation into DNA, causes alterations in chromatin structure, which can indirectly enhance 1110059E24Rik activity.
